Microsoft Corporation (MSFT) - Ansoff Matrix: Market Penetration
You're looking at how Microsoft Corporation can grow by selling more of its current offerings into its existing customer base. This is about deepening relationships, not finding new territory or new products. Here's the quick math on where the current penetration stands and the targets for this strategy.
Azure Cloud Market Share Expansion
The push here is to close the gap with the market leader in cloud infrastructure. As of the third quarter of 2025, Microsoft Azure holds a 20% share of the global cloud infrastructure market, which is where you need to focus your efforts to move past that number. The total global cloud infrastructure spending hit $107 billion in Q3 2025. Microsoft's Intelligent Cloud group posted $30.9 billion in sales for Q3 2025, giving the platform an annualized revenue run rate of $123 billion. Your goal is to push that 20% share higher, narrowing the distance to the 29% share held by Amazon Web Services in Q3 2025.
Driving Higher-Tier Copilot Conversions
The initial adoption of Copilot is strong, with the free Copilot Chat experience now included for eligible Microsoft 365 Business or Enterprise tenants. The real financial lift comes from converting users to the full, integrated experience. The paid add-on, Copilot for Microsoft 365, is priced at $30 per user per month. This higher-tier seat unlocks deep integration across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ook, Teams, and Graph-connected data, which is where the productivity gains-and revenue-are realized. You need to focus on migrating users from the included Chat experience to this paid automation layer.
Deepening Dynamics 365 Integration
Market penetration for Dynamics 365 means embedding it deeper within the massive existing Microsoft 365 customer base. As of 2025, an estimated 35,000+ companies worldwide use Microsoft Dynamics 365. The overall Microsoft Dynamics market size is projected to reach $11.42 billion in 2025,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 12% from 2024. The revenue for the Dynamics Products And Cloud Services segment was $7.83 B in fiscal year 2025. The action here is cross-selling the combined CRM/ERP capabilities to M365 customers who are currently using competitor ERP/CRM solutions or legacy systems.
Boosting Devices Segment Sales via Bundling
To penetrate the current market for Windows 11 and Surface devices, aggressive bundling discounts are the lever. The Devices segment generated $17.31 B in revenue for Microsoft Corporation in fiscal year 2025. This represented a massive 267.91% increase from the $4.71 B reported in fiscal year 2024. You should use this momentum to offer compelling price reductions when packaging Surface hardware with Microsoft 365 subscriptions, aiming to increase unit volume within the existing enterprise and consumer install base.
Here is a snapshot of the relevant segment financials for fiscal year 2025:
| Segment | FY 2025 Revenue (USD) | YoY Growth Rate |
| Devices | $17.31 B | 267.91% |
| Gaming | $23.46 B | 9.08% |
| Dynamics Products And Cloud Services | $7.83 B | 20.77% |
Expanding Xbox Game Pass Subscriptions
The focus for Xbox Game Pass is driving more users within the current gaming market to subscribe, particularly to the premium tiers. As of mid-2025, the service has reached approximately 35 to 37 million active subscribers. The global subscription-based gaming market itself is estimated to be worth $11.99 billion USD in 2025. Promotional pricing on the service is key to increasing the subscriber count from its current base. The most valuable tier, Game Pass Ultimate, already accounts for 68% of the total user base.
Key metrics for the Gaming segment and Game Pass penetration include:
- Xbox Game Pass Subscribers (Mid-2025): 35 to 37 million
- Game Pass Ultimate Tier Share: 68% of total subscribers
- Microsoft Gaming Revenue (FY 2025): $23.46 B
- Global Subscription Gaming Market Size (2025 Est.): $11.99 billion USD
- Hours Streamed via Cloud Gaming (2024): 1.2 billion hours

Microsoft Corporation (MSFT) - Ansoff Matrix: Market Development
Targeting new geographic regions with existing Azure cloud services means expanding the data center footprint where demand is emerging. Microsoft Azure is present in over 60+ regions worldwide and has more than 185 global network PoPs. During fiscal year 2025, new Azure datacenter regions were launched in Malaysia and Indonesia. The company plans further expansion with new regions set for India and Taiwan in 2026. For instance, the Indonesia Central region launched in May 2025, equipped with three availability zones.
Pushing existing Azure cloud services into highly regulated, specialized verticals shows a focus on compliance-driven market development. A new Azure for U.S. Government Secret region is now generally available, designed for classified workloads. Furthermore, the Sovereign Public Cloud, which ensures customer data stays in Europe under European Law with operations controlled by European personnel, is available in preview across all European datacenter regions, with general availability planned later in the year. This strategy leverages the $75 billion in Azure revenue achieved in FY2025, which grew 34%.
Expanding LinkedIn's Enterprise Services into new mid-market segments globally is supported by its overall scale. LinkedIn Corporation generated total revenue of $17.81 billion in FY2025, an increase of 9% year-over-year. The Enterprise Services component specifically generated $7.76 billion in FY2025. This segment growth is part of the broader Productivity and Business Processes group, which saw revenue of $33.1 billion in Q4 FY2025.
Launching Xbox Game Pass streaming on non-console devices targets markets with lower console penetration. The cloud gaming offering supports titles available across cloud, console, and PC, including new hardware like the ROG Xbox Ally handhelds. The Gaming segment overall contributed $23.46 billion to Microsoft Corporation's total FY2025 revenue of $281 billion.
Adapting Microsoft 365 Commercial for small-to-medium businesses (SMBs) in emerging economies involves tiered pricing strategies. The Microsoft 365 Commercial Products and Cloud Services segment generated $87.77 billion in FY2025 revenue. This segment's cloud revenue growth was driven by a 6% seat growth, which specifically included contributions from small and medium businesses and frontline worker offerings.
The overall financial context for these market development efforts in FY2025 includes:
| Metric | Amount/Value |
| Total FY2025 Revenue | $281 billion |
| Total FY2025 Operating Income | $128 billion |
| Microsoft Cloud Annual Revenue (FY2025) | $168 billion |
| Copilot Monthly Active Users (FY2025) | 100 million |
| Microsoft Fabric Paid Customers (FY2025) | 25,000 |
These market expansion activities are supported by the company's scale, as evidenced by the $128 billion in operating income for the full fiscal year 2025.
Microsoft Corporation (MSFT) - Ansoff Matrix: Product Development
For existing customers, the integration of new product capabilities drives immediate revenue capture. You're looking at embedding the latest security innovations directly where your enterprise base already resides.
The new AI security agent, Project Ire, is being integrated into Microsoft Defender. This builds upon existing security investments, where Microsoft Defender showed a 242% return on investment over three years, according to a 2025 commissioned Forrester Consulting Total Economic Impact study. Security Copilot, which includes these agentic capabilities, is now included for all Microsoft 365 E5 customers, with rollout continuing in the upcoming months following the November 2025 announcement at Ignite. This targets the existing base that already subscribes to the Microsoft 365 E5 tier.
The push into hardware with dedicated silicon for on-device generative AI features is represented by the 'Copilot+ PCs.' Shipments of Windows PCs with the required 40+ TOPS (trillion operations per second) for the Copilot+ designation totaled 1.2 million units in the first quarter of 2025. Total AI PCs sold in that same period reached 58.4 million units, showing the broader market adoption trend that Microsoft is aiming to capture with its premium offering. The initial launch saw Copilot+ PCs priced 57 percent higher than the average notebook price across Europe in the final quarter of the previous year.
For the Intelligent Cloud segment, the commercial launch of Azure Quantum services is a key product development for specialized computing. Microsoft and Atom Computing are offering a reliable quantum machine built with state-of-the-art logical qubits, available to order in 2024 with delivery slated for 2025. This offering integrates Microsoft's qubit-virtualization system with Azure Elements, which uses AI and high-performance computing for research in areas like chemistry and materials science. The platform supports partners like IonQ and Quantinuum.
Developing a new, unified consumer subscription bundles existing successful products with new AI tools. The Microsoft 365 Consumer products and cloud services segment generated $7.40 billion in revenue for fiscal year 2025. This segment ended FY2025 with 89.0 million Microsoft 365 Consumer paid subscribers, reflecting an 8 percent year-over-year subscriber growth. The cloud revenue for this consumer offering grew 11 percent in the fourth quarter of FY2025, partly due to a price increase announced in January 2025.
Rolling out new, advanced features for the established LinkedIn platform targets the existing user base of 1.2 billion members. The LinkedIn segment generated $17.81 billion in revenue in fiscal year 2025. New AI-powered tools are being deployed across its core businesses. For instance, the LinkedIn Hiring Assistant helps recruiters review 60 percent fewer profiles on average, saving nearly 30 percent of the time to fill a role. Furthermore, the new AI-powered job search is already being used by about one million members daily. Comments on the platform rose over 30 percent year-over-year in the fourth quarter of FY2025.

Microsoft Corporation (MSFT) - Ansoff Matrix: Diversification
You're looking at Microsoft Corporation's aggressive push into entirely new markets, which is the definition of diversification in the Ansoff Matrix. This isn't just tweaking existing products; it's building new revenue streams from the ground up.
Industrial Metaverse Platform via Acquisition
Acquiring a major industrial automation or robotics player would position Microsoft to own the Industrial Metaverse platform layer. While a specific acquisition price isn't public for this hypothetical, we know Microsoft is already positioned as an enabler in this space. In a recent ranking of robotics-adjacent technology leaders, Microsoft scored 24/40, specifically recognized for its AI, cloud robotics platforms, and industrial digital-twin systems. This suggests the foundation for such a platform is being built on existing cloud capabilities, like Azure, which reported revenue growth of 34% for Azure and other cloud services in fiscal year 2025.
- Industrial automation demand remains strong globally.
- Microsoft's existing digital-twin systems provide a starting point.
New Consumer-Facing Hardware Line
Launching a new consumer hardware line, perhaps smart home devices running proprietary Microsoft AI, moves the company further into the consumer electronics space beyond the Xbox. For context on the existing devices business, the Windows and Devices segment revenue for fiscal year 2025 was $17.31 billion. This segment is smaller than the Intelligent Cloud segment, which brought in $29.9 billion in Q4 FY25 alone. The success of a new hardware line would depend on integrating that proprietary AI to create a compelling user experience that justifies the investment.
Establishing a FinTech Division
Leveraging Dynamics 365 and Azure to offer specialized FinTech solutions represents a deep dive into the financial services vertical. The growth in this area is already strong; Dynamics products and cloud services revenue increased 18% in Q4 FY25, with Dynamics 365 revenue specifically growing 23% year-over-year. The broader Productivity and Business Processes segment, which houses Dynamics, posted $33.1 billion in revenue for Q4 FY25. A dedicated FinTech division would aim to capture a larger share of that transaction value.
Entering the Dedicated AI Chip Design Market
Moving from partnership to direct competition in silicon design is a massive capital undertaking. Microsoft's internal silicon efforts, like the Azure Maia AI accelerator, are central to this. While the company is committed to this path, the latest generation AI chip, Maia 200, has seen its mass production timeline pushed back from 2025 to 2026 due to design revisions. This strategic pivot involves simplifying designs through 2028, focusing on optimization. Microsoft's overall commitment to AI infrastructure is underscored by its planned $80 billion USD investment in AI-enabled data centers globally for fiscal year 2025.
Standalone Carbon Removal and Sustainability Unit
Creating a standalone business unit for carbon removal services capitalizes on Microsoft's existing commitments and technological advancements in data center efficiency. The company's commitment to sustainability is massive; in fiscal year 2024, Microsoft negotiated agreements for 22 million metric tonnes of carbon removal, exceeding the total of the previous four years combined. Furthermore, Microsoft has contracted 34 gigawatts (GW) of carbon-free electricity across 24 countries to date. The company aims to be carbon negative by 2030. This unit could commercialize the energy-efficient data center technology, which includes designs that eliminate water usage for cooling, potentially preventing up to 125,000 cubic metres of consumption per facility annually.
Here's a quick look at the scale of Microsoft Corporation's operations as context for these diversification efforts:
| Metric | FY 2025 Value | Comparison/Context |
|---|---|---|
| Total Revenue | $281.7 billion | Up 14.9% from $245.1 billion in FY 2024. |
| Net Income | $101.8 billion | Reflects record financial performance. |
| Azure Revenue | Exceeded $75 billion | Growth rate of 34%. |
| Microsoft Cloud Revenue | $168.9 billion | Increased 27% year-over-year. |
| R&D Expense Growth | Increased 10% | Driven by cloud and AI investments. |
| Carbon Removal Agreements (FY24) | 22 million metric tonnes | Exceeded previous four years combined. |
The sheer scale of the existing Intelligent Cloud segment, with revenue of $29.9 billion in the fourth quarter of fiscal year 2025, provides the financial engine for these new ventures. Still, success in diversification requires more than just capital; it needs market traction.
